<p>HLB Specialties, known for its papayas, has begun importing Guatemalan rambutan fruit. Launching the last week of June, the rambutan fruit hit Florida stores of major national retailer. In various stores in South Florida, HLB Specialties will introduce the fruit by creating tasting demos that explain how to prepare the fruit in meals.<hr class="legacyRuler"><hr class="legacyRuler"><hr class="invisible minimal-padding"><hr class="invisible minimal-padding">The rambutan is an exotic fruit similar to a lychee or a mamoncillo, but contains pulp and no fibers. It tastes juicy and sweet like a grape gummy. It is shelled with red spikes, which contributed to the fruits nickname, “messy hair.” To further the publicity of the ramputan, the fruit was recently promoted at a soccer match in Miami by Argentinean soccer star Lionel Messi.<hr class="legacyRuler"><hr class="legacyRuler"><hr class="invisible minimal-padding"><hr class="invisible minimal-padding">In response to the soccer match, Mr. Lorenz Hartmann de Barros, Director of Sales at HLB Specialties stated, “The responses varied from curious stares to exclamations of recognition from people who knew the fruit from their home countries such as Honduras and Costa Rica… They ate the rambutans and even asked for more.”<hr class="legacyRuler"><hr class="legacyRuler"><hr class="invisible minimal-padding"><hr class="invisible minimal-padding">Ideal for retailers, HLB Specialties carries the rambutans in a four- count clamshell. The clamshell extends its shelf life, protects from mishandling, while retaining the proper humidity. According to a press release, buyers can order them in 5lb bulk box and 5.8lb boxes, each box containing 24 clamshells.
